Pohang Techno Park (PTP) hosted the 2026 International Conference on the Green Bio Industry on September 2–3, bringing together experts and representatives from industry, academia, research institutions and government from Korea and overseas. Co-hosted by Gyeongsangbuk-do and Pohang City and organized by Pohang Techno Park , the two-day conference focused on strengthening international cooperation in the green bio industry, with particular emphasis on veterinary pharmaceuticals, animal healthcare and global market expansion .

The conference was designed not only to share the latest technologies and market trends, but also to create practical opportunities for Korean green bio companies to connect with international partners and advance into overseas markets.

A joint session involving POSTECH and Kyungpook National University’s College of Veterinary Medicine highlighted recent research and industry trends in plant-based platform technologies, veterinary pharmaceuticals, exosomes, regenerative medicine and companion-animal healthcare. Particular attention was given to expanding access to the European Union market . During the Korea–Lithuania cooperation session, representatives discussed strategies for entering the EU veterinary pharmaceutical market. Lithuanian University of Health Sciences, Ratbio, Grassmedi and Pohang Techno Park signed a memorandum of understanding (MOU) to strengthen cooperation aimed at expanding into the European market.

Through the conference, PTP is positioning itself as a platform connecting local green bio companies with global partners , supporting the full process from technology development and commercialization to international market expansion. PTP is also developing a broader support ecosystem through the Green Bio Venture Campus, which is intended to foster promising green bio ventures and support their growth and global expansion.

The conference marks another step in Pohang’s efforts to establish itself as a global hub for green bio innovation , particularly in green vaccines, veterinary pharmaceuticals and animal healthcare, while creating tangible pathways for local companies to enter international markets.
